The 2025 Season Recap: What You Missed

If you’re asking about what time is the nebraska football game tomorrow because you’ve lost track of the season, here’s the quick and dirty version of what happened. Matt Rhule’s squad showed some serious grit. They finished the regular season with some massive highs, including a nail-biter against Maryland and a dominant showing against Akron.

They faced a tough loss against Iowa in the regular-season finale (40-16), which is always a tough pill to swallow for those of us in the 402 area code. However, they earned a trip to the Las Vegas Bowl on December 31, 2025. They played Utah, and while the 44-22 scoreline wasn’t what we wanted, the fact that Nebraska was playing ball on New Year's Eve says a lot about the direction of the program.

Looking Ahead to the 2026 Schedule

Since there’s no game tomorrow, you might want to mark your calendars for the return of the real deal. The 2026 season is already taking shape. It kicks off at Memorial Stadium in September.

  1. September 5, 2026: Nebraska vs. Ohio
  2. September 12, 2026: Nebraska vs. Bowling Green
  3. September 19, 2026: Nebraska vs. North Dakota
